Ticket #— Floor 9 Opening Prep, Brindlemoor House

Hi facilities folks, Floor 9 opens to staff next Monday and we need a few things squared away before then. Lift access is live, but the two side doors by the kitchenette are still on the old lock config — please reprogram them before Friday. Also, signage for the quiet rooms hasn't arrived, so pop up the temporary printed ones for now. Until the badge readers sync, the interim door code for Floor 9 is below.

door code, bajop-bajog: bdg-DSWAC-43621

Action item from the Brindlewick checkout outage: the legacy ORM layer in cartsvc still generates unbounded joins under load. Owner: platform pod. Plan: extract query builders into the new Fennel data layer, add statement timeouts, delete the old mapper by end of quarter. Tracked as P1. Interim mitigation (row limits) is live. Migration checklist, sequencing, and rollback notes are on the internal page.

dashboard of taweg-fahag = https://jira.tolvaqlabs.internal/projects/pages/display/1c228fd7

### Step 4: Configure the Proctor Queue

Plugins for the Examgate proctoring queue connect through the Wrenfield broker. Set `PROCTOR_QUEUE_NAME` to your assigned channel and `PROCTOR_CONCURRENCY` to a value of 4 or lower. Message acknowledgment is mandatory; unacked sessions are requeued after 90 seconds. Before your plugin can subscribe, the broker requires authentication, so add the following line to your environment file:

env line for kageg-fajof: COURIER_KEY5=93d14

Welcome to the Furrowlink team. The telemetry gateway collects sensor data from tractors in the Hollowdale pilot fleet and forwards it to our ingest cluster every five minutes. Your first task is verifying the MQTT bridge config on the staging box. If the admin account locks you out during setup, recover it with the passphrase below.

unlock words, hahip-baduf: holwyn-istath-julvan